Use of source test reports in developing emission factors

摘要

During the last 3 years, Pacific Environmental Services, Inc. (PES) collected over 2,500 source test reports from 27 State and local air pollution control agencies int eh United States. To date, over 2,100 of these reports have been evaluated and assigned a ratign for potential use in emission factor developmnet. Of these 2,100 + source test reports, 38 percent received an "A" rating, 31 percent a "B" rating, 19 percent a "C" rating, and 12 percent a "D" rating. The most common reason for a poorer rating was the lack of documentation of the reference method procedure includign the failure to provide a discussion of the test procedures followed, the field data sheets, and the laboraotry data. Significant variation int he percent of the test reports receiving an A rating was found among agencies and among test methods. State and local agencies have different standards for acceptability that result in different levels of quality in the source test report submitted. More frequently used test methods received consistently more "A" ratings than those used less frequently. Many opportunities exist for future source tests and the resulting reports to generate and provide additional inforamtion and data to help build a more reliable emission factor data base.
